2009-09-15 Antoniu Pop <antoniu.pop@gmail.com>
* omp-low.c (var_stream, lower_send_clauses): New field is_pushed,
used to avoid issuing multiple push calls .
(lower_send_clauses, expand_omp_taskreg, stream_create_calls):
Fixed errors in the code generation.
